Re: would a engine block heater cause the ecm to go crazy?
Posted to Emissions Forum on 1/1/2002 1 Reply

The use of a block heater would not cause a PCM to set a DTC. The IAT/ECT comparison youare refering to is simply a reference for the technician to estimate if the sensors are skewed.
